#1, free accounts get access to a rotating hero pool of 15 heroes. They can unlock heroes by buying them in the store for 250 gold or 350 silver (so I heard, haven't verified those numbers).
Also, free accounts do not have unlimited access to all matchmaking types/modes.
Current owners of the game got upgraded to legacy -> full access to the general hero pool, option to play 'verified only' matchmaking (only with verified players, i.e. those that have spent at least $30 in the store OR reached level 5).
Additionally, they added 'early access' to the shop, where some heroes are put in. They can be bought with gold coins and then users can play that hero before it is officially released to the public (monkey king, for example, came out as 'early access'. For 250 gold coins, you could unlock him. He will be added to the general hero pool in about a month, on the 26th of August or such).
It is NOT a limited period of F2P. It's permanent, and they've significantly changed the setup of their game to support that. |
